SUBJECT: 2010-2011 U.S. News & World Report Hospital Rankings

Consumers use a wide variety of resources these days to select a hospital for medical care as more health data becomes public. Several organizations provide lists that rank hospitals using various criteria. This week, U.S. News & World Report, a national magazine, released its annual ranking of the best hospitals in the United States.

..Two Maryland acute care hospitals – Washington Adventist Hospital in Takoma Park and Shady Grove Adventist Hospital in Rockville – were ranked on the Washington, D.C. market list. Washington Adventist was listed 4th and Shady Grove Adventist 17th. Additionally, Washington Adventist Hospital was ranked 43rd nationally out of the top 152 hospitals for its Neurology/Neurosurgery department.

For the 2010-2011 national list, U.S. News evaluated nearly 5,000 hospitals, in 16 adult specialties, based on specific criteria that include death rates, patient safety, reputation among doctors, technology, nurse staffing and measures of quality care. For the Washington, D.C. area list, hospitals qualified based on their placements on the national list, as well as stringent benchmarks that include volumes for certain types of cases.
